AHS Newark Dogs Available at PetSmart Adoption Event, Jan. 9
BRIDGEWATER, NJ – Several dogs from the Associated Humane Societies’ Newark Animal shelter will be the first to greet patrons of the Bridgewater PetSmart during the store’s first Adoption Event, from noon to 3 p.m. on Sunday, January 9, in the hopes of finding their forever homes.
Some of the dogs include: Baylee, a young Golden Retriever/Dachshund mix who was abandoned in front of the shelter on Christmas Eve; Percy, an adult male purebred Pomeranian; and Blu, a five-month-old Pit Bull who was brought to the shelter just days after being given as a Christmas gift.
“These dogs are just a small representation of the many animals currently available for adoption at our Newark shelter,” said Roseann Trezza, Executive Director, Associated Humane Societies/Popcorn Park. “We hope the dogs find families to love them at this event, and that others who visit PetSmart on Sunday are inspired to visit our shelters and find new family members of their own.”
All the dogs at the event have been temperament evaluated, given shots, microchips and will be spayed or neutered upon adoption. Standard adoption fees apply to all of the animals at the event.
